About the role

  • Provide corporate-level support to the Solutions Specialists, Architects and Raízen business units in delivering initiatives;
  • Promote the evolution of technology architecture, governance and the maturity of the Corporate Architecture team;
  • Preserve existing capabilities and drive simplification, efficiency, reuse and a future-oriented vision;
  • Evolve and maintain the corporate architecture framework;
  • Influence stakeholders using knowledge and market best practices;
  • Perform assessments with business and IT;
  • Manage conflicts proactively;
  • Manage the corporate architecture repository;

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Systems, Business Administration or related fields;
  • Postgraduate degree or MBA in Enterprise Architecture, Solution Architecture, Digital Transformation or IT Management is a plus;
  • Desired certifications: TOGAF, AWS/Azure/OCI Architect, ITIL, PMP;
  • English: Advanced/Fluent (reading, writing and speaking);
  • Capability mapping, domain modeling and the ability to train these disciplines at the corporate level;
  • Proficiency with architecture frameworks and solution modeling (C4, ArchiMate, TOGAF, Zachman);
  • Experience with modeling tools (Archi, Sparx EA, Bizzdesign);
  • Proficiency in c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, OCI or GCP);
  • Knowledge of Design Systems and front-end and back-end development frameworks (.NET, .NET Core, Python, React, Angular, etc.);
  • Knowledge of documentation patterns (DDD — Domain-Driven Design) and implementation of integrations and event-driven architectures: SOAP/REST APIs, WebSockets, API Gateway, ESB, messaging (MQ/Kafka), microservices, MCP Gateways and iPaaS;
  • Knowledge of data architecture, governance and modeling (relational and non-relational);
  • Knowledge of AI- and ML-oriented architectures;
  • Experience with documentation, management and control tools (GitHub, Confluence, ServiceNow);
  • Skill in creating executive, tactical and technical presentations in PowerPoint;
  • Familiarity with data governance, information security and compliance (LGPD and SOX).
